39aeb658a32ca206a312cfcf338b531742a346aabc914778c5776d2aff091a97

1617225 (106886 blocks ago)

⏴ Block 1617224 (cf67ad54...5e4) | Block 1617226 ⏵ | Latest block ⏭

Metadata

19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details